This page was machine-translated from English. Report issues.

Como criar um rastreador de finanças de manutenção e melhoria doméstica para Android

Um aplicativo Android para rastrear as finanças de manutenção e melhoria da casa, com uma interface amigável, persistência de dados e responsividade móvel.

Create your own plan

Learn2Vibe AI

Online

AI

What do you want to build?

Resumo Simples

Planejar desenvolver um aplicativo Android para rastrear as finanças de manutenção e melhoria da casa com uma interface amigável e persistência de dados.

Documento de Requisitos do Produto (PRD)

Objetivos:

  • Criar um rastreador de finanças amigável para manutenção e melhorias domésticas
  • Implementar a persistência de dados para acompanhamento de longo prazo
  • Garantir a responsividade móvel para dispositivos Android

Principais recursos:

  • Interface amigável ao usuário
  • Persistência de dados
  • Responsividade móvel

Fluxos de Usuário

N/A

Especificações Técnicas

Pilha recomendada:

  • Android SDK para desenvolvimento de aplicativos nativos
  • Banco de dados local (por exemplo, SQLite) para persistência de dados
  • Estruturas de design responsivas para Android

Endpoints da API

N/A

Esquema do Banco de Dados

N/A

Estrutura de Arquivos

app/ ├── src/ │ ├── main/ │ │ ├── java/ │ │ │ └── com.example.homefinancetracker/ │ │ │ ├── activities/ │ │ │ ├── adapters/ │ │ │ ├── models/ │ │ │ ├── database/ │ │ │ └── utils/ │ │ ├── res/ │ │ │ ├── layout/ │ │ │ ├── values/ │ │ │ └── drawable/ │ │ └── AndroidManifest.xml │ └── test/ ├── build.gradle └── proguard-rules.pro

Plano de Implementação

  1. Configurar o ambiente de desenvolvimento Android
  2. Projetar protótipos da interface do usuário
  3. Implementar os componentes básicos da interface do usuário
  4. Configurar o banco de dados local para persistência de dados
  5. Implementar a funcionalidade principal de rastreamento de finanças
  6. Garantir a responsividade móvel
  7. Implementar recursos de entrada e recuperação de dados
  8. Realizar testes e correções de bugs
  9. Otimizar o desempenho e a experiência do usuário
  10. Preparar para o lançamento na Google Play Store

Estratégia de Implantação

N/A

Justificativa do Design

As decisões de design se concentram em criar uma interface amigável ao usuário com persistência de dados para acompanhamento de longo prazo, projetada especificamente para dispositivos Android para garantir a responsividade e funcionalidade adequadas.